For travellers looking for a Singapore hotel that rises above the rest, it’s difficult to look beyond Swissotel The Stamford.
This is mainly because, measuring 226 metres from lobby to rooftop, it is the tallest hotel in the country. In fact, when completed in 1986 it was the tallest hotel in the whole of Asia, but while other hotels have since risen above Swissotel The Stamford in terms of height, few are able to match it terms of facilities.
Located in the centre of Singapore, in a complex adjoining the Raffles City Convention Centre and shopping complex, Swissotel The Stamford can quite literally boast everything under one roof – albeit a very high roof.
The hotel offers 1,261 rooms, all equipped with flat-screen televisions, work desks and multi-adaptor plug sockets, which make it wonderfully simple to get to get to work as soon as you arrive. Or for those wanting to relax and take in their surroundings, all rooms offer private balconies, with views across the city. But that’s only the tip of the proverbial iceberg when it comes to this hotel’s amenities…
For diners, the property features no fewer than 16 food and beverage outlets including the Equinox Complex – a complete entertainment hub on the upper floors of the hotel, featuring five restaurants and bars, a nightclub and four private dining rooms.
The most spectacular of them all has to be JAAN – a contemporary French fine dining restaurant that serves up pure culinary theatre. Led by Chef Julien Royer, this 40-seat restaurant offers a seasonal menu of stunning dishes that foam, fizz and smoke, both at the table and on the tastebuds. Expect such inventive creations as grilled Landes foie gras with strawberries, confit Arctic char with almonds, and rosemary ice cream, all accompanied by spectacular views across Marina Bay.
Of course Singapore now is one of the world’s centres for the meeting and conference industry, and Swissotel The Stamford offers more than 6,500m² of floor space, including 27 meeting rooms and the 3,200-delegate capacity Raffles Ballroom. And for those wanting to unwind, the hotel’s Willow Stream Spa is one of Asia’s largest, offering 35 private treatment rooms, a huge fitness centre, two outdoor swimming pools and six tennis courts.
So certainly the numbers seem to add up (and then some) for Swissotel The Stamford, but what is the guest experience like? Well, with any hotel catering to more than 2,000 guests at a time, you can’t help but lose something of the personal touch. But the staff seem to cope admirably, with minimal waiting times at breakfast and a reception desk always willing to help.
But what really impresses is the sheer convenience of the hotel. Everything is fast and efficient; and with the huge Raffles City shopping complex just steps away, even the busiest guest can pop out of their meeting, do some shopping, grab a coffee and then return for their next appointment. The only danger is you might not make it outside the hotel!
In Singapore’s fast-growing hotel industry, the Swissotel The Stamford still rises above the crowd, both literally and figuratively.
